    Senate
    In Letter to Reid, 41 Republican Senators Commit to Rejecting All Byrd Rule Violations ‘The Byrd Rule, as you know, was created by Senator Byrd to ensure that reconciliation bills were not used to enact policy changes, the primary purpose of which is not specifically related to the federal budget. As it takes 60 votes to waive the Byrd Rule, we can ensure that any provision that trips the Byrd Rule will be stripped from the bill, which will require that the bill be sent back to the House for further consideration and additional votes’ WASHINGTON, DC – The Senate...

  • Murtha’s technology show is showcase for contractors

    05/23/2007 7:08:44 AM PDT · by Gulf War One · 7 replies · 395+ views
    The Hill ^ | May 23, 2007 | Roxana Tiron
    What started with a few folding tables at a hotel in Johnstown, Pa., 16 years ago is now one of the country’s most popular technology trade shows. Defense giants and regional companies alike clamor to participate in what it is known as the “Showcase for Commerce.” The event also is a showcase for one powerful member of Congress: Rep. John Murtha (D-Pa.), chairman of the House Appropriations defense subcommittee. The lawmaker, who conceived of the show, now held at the Cambria County War Memorial Arena, spends time there each year, visiting every exhibit booth and talking to contractors. The Johnstown...
